Three new movies to watch with the kids

E-mail comment on this item

altTired of Beauty and the Beast, Aladdin and The Lion King? Some of today's more recent flicks are just as charming, funny and winning as the classics. If you need a new film to watch with your little ones, here are three of this generation's best animated options that are sure to win the hearts of kids and grownups alike.

1. Rio. This visually stunning tale about a domesticated blue macaw lost in the jungles of Brazil is a visual feast. Not only is it full of endearing and adorable characters (with familiar voices - Jesse Eisenberg, Anne Hathaway and Tracy Morgan all lent their talents to the flick), it's virtually exploding with color and beauty. Go ahead, try to tear your eyes away during the Carnivale scene - you won't be able to look away!

2. Bolt. If your family owns a dog, there won't be a dry eye in the house when this flick wraps up. It's earnest, sincere and charming, and features an adorable pup who is bound to remind you of your own canine companion. Kids will love the fuzzy critters, and there are a few treats thrown in for adults, too.

3. Finding Nemo. It's a few years old by now, but this winning, unique and gorgeous film is as great as ever. If your kids like being under the sea with Ariel, they'll adore Nemo.
